    This means that Czech citizens could travel to 162 countries and territories visa-free or can obtain visa on arrival. [25] In 2009 Czech citizens could travel to 131 countries without a visa, [26] to 142 in 2010, [27] 152 in 2012, [28] 167 in 2016, [29] 168 in 2017, [30] 182 in 2018, [31] 181 in 2019, [32] and 183 in 2020.     Under Compacts of Free Association, citizens of the Marshall Islands, Micronesia and Palau may enter, reside, study and work in the United States indefinitely without a visa. These benefits are granted to citizens from birth or independence , and to naturalized citizens who have resided in the respective country for at least five years ...

    Visa requirements for Polish citizens are public health and administrative entry restrictions by the authorities of other states placed on citizens of Poland. As of 2025, Polish citizens have visa-free or visa on arrival access to 188 countries and territories, ranking the Polish passport 7th in the world according to the Henley Passport Index. [1]
